How to Authenticate and Restore Sony Vegas Pro 12 (64-bit) Vegas Pro 12, originally released by Sony Creative Software, remains a staple for many video editors who prefer its classic 64-bit workflow. However, modern users often run into trouble when trying to authenticate or move their license to a new machine because the original Sony registration servers are no longer active.
If you’re stuck at the activation window, here is how you can legally manage your Sony Vegas Pro 12 authentication. 1. Migrating to the MAGIX Ecosystem
In 2016, MAGIX acquired the Vegas Pro line from Sony. Consequently, all legitimate Sony serial numbers were migrated to the MAGIX service center.
Account Recovery: Try logging into the MAGIX My Service Center using the same email you used for your Sony account.
Registration: If your version isn't showing, you can manually re-register your Sony serial number here to receive a fresh installer and authentication. 2. Finding a Lost Authentication Code
If you have the software installed but lost your records, you might still find your keys on your hard drive:
Windows Registry: Your serial and activation keys are often stored in the registry. Navigate to:H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Sony Creative Software\Vegas Pro\12.0
Software Menu: If you can still open the program, go to Help > Deactivate the software on this PC. The window that pops up often displays your full serial number before you actually confirm deactivation. 3. Solving "Out of Authentication Codes"
Vegas Pro 12 typically allowed a limited number of concurrent activations. If you see an error stating you've run out of codes:
Deactivate Old Systems: Log into your MAGIX account and look for "My Products." You can manually deactivate old computer IDs to free up a slot for your current 64-bit installation.
Contact Support: If the automated system fails, you must contact MAGIX Support directly, as they now hold the license database. Quick Specs Recap for Vegas Pro 12

1. The Difference Between Serial Numbers and Authentication Codes
When you first install Vegas Pro 12, the software usually asks for two distinct pieces of information:
Serial Number: This usually starts with 1TR- and is the unique ID you received when you purchased the software.
Authentication Code: This is a much longer string of characters. Back in the day, after you entered your serial number and registered the product online, Sony’s servers would generate this code to "unlock" the software on that specific computer. 2. Why "Free" Codes Online Don't Work
If you are searching for a "universal" authentication code or a "keygen," you’ll likely find a lot of dead ends or, worse, malware.
Hardware ID Binding: Authentication codes are usually tied to your specific computer's hardware ID. A code that worked for someone else in 2014 will not work on your machine today.
Server Migrations: Since Magix bought Vegas Pro from Sony, many of the old Sony Creative Software registration servers have been decommissioned or moved. 3. How to Properly Activate a Legacy License
If you actually own a legal license for Vegas Pro 12, here is how you should handle the authentication:
Check your Magix/Sony Account: Log in to the Magix Service Center. If you registered your old Sony products, they are often migrated here. You can find your serial numbers and activation history.
Offline Activation: If the software can’t "phone home" to the server, it may offer an "Activate from another computer" option. This generates a file you can upload to the Magix website to receive your code manually.
Run as Administrator: Old Sony software often fails to write the license file to the Registry unless you right-click the installer (or the app icon) and select "Run as Administrator." 4. Compatibility Issues on 64-bit Systems
While Vegas 12 was designed for 64-bit Windows, it was built for Windows 7 and 8.
Windows 10/11: You might experience crashes during the activation screen. How to Authenticate and Restore Sony Vegas Pro
The Fix: Right-click the .exe, go to Properties > Compatibility, and set it to run in compatibility mode for Windows 7. 5. Is it time to move on?

If you have lost your code or need to recover it for a reinstallation:
Magix Account: Since Sony sold its creative software line to MAGIX in 2016, you can find your registered serial numbers and codes by logging into your MAGIX Customer Account and checking the "My Products" page.
Windows Registry: If the software is currently (or was recently) installed, codes may be stored in the Windows Registry at:H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Sony Creative Software\Vegas Pro\12.0.
Email Confirmation: Look for original purchase confirmation emails from Sony or MAGIX, as these typically contain the necessary serial number and activation details. Activation Troubleshooting
Old Sony Servers: Note that original Sony activation servers may no longer be active. Newer installers from the VEGAS Creative Software site are often updated to connect to MAGIX servers instead.
License Deactivation: If you receive an error about too many activations, you may need to deactivate an older instance of the software through your online account before it can be installed on a new machine.
